Frequently Asked Questions

What is the median home sale price in Maricopa County, AZ?
In the last 30 days, the median home sale price in Maricopa County was $491,799, up 4.9% compared to the same period last year. The "median" price is the middle price - half of the homes here were sold for less, the other half for more.
How many homes are for sale in Maricopa County, AZ?
There were 21,196 homes for sale in Maricopa County as of October 10, 2025. There were 7,133 new listings within the last 30 days as well. The more homes on the market, the more choices buyers have.

How much competition is there to buy a home in Maricopa County, AZ?
In the last 30 days, the median number of days a home in Maricopa County remained on the market (DOM) was 44.17. In areas with a low DOM, homes are sold quickly and the competition is fierce; in areas with higher DOMs, you may have more options and more time to make an offer.
